To study the rate at which animals learn, a psychology student performed an experiment in which a rat was sent repeatedly through a laboratory maze. Suppose the time required for the rat to traverse the maze on the nth trial was approximately T(n)=5+2n4n2T ( n ) = 5 + \frac { 2 } { n } - \frac { 4 } { n ^ { 2 } } minutes. How many minutes does it take the rat to traverse the maze on the 2nd trial?
